hyophilisé, also known as freeze-drying, is a process that involves removing water from a product by freezing it and then turning the frozen water into vapor. This process is widely used in the food industry to preserve food and extend its shelf life without the need for refrigeration. hyophilisé not only helps in food preservation but also retains the original taste, texture, and nutritional value of the food product.

The process of hyophilisé starts with freezing the food product at very low temperatures. Once the food is frozen, it is placed in a vacuum chamber where the pressure is lowered to allow the frozen water in the food to vaporize. This vapor is then collected and removed, leaving behind a dehydrated and lightweight food product. The final result is a product that is stable at room temperature and can be easily rehydrated by adding water or any liquid.

There are several benefits of hyophilisé, particularly in the food industry. One of the main advantages of this process is the preservation of the food product for an extended period. By removing water from the food, hyophilisé prevents the growth of bacteria, mold, and yeast that can spoil the food. This makes hyophilisé an excellent method for preserving perishable foods such as fruits, vegetables, meats, and even dairy products.

Another benefit of hyophilisé is that it helps in retaining the original flavor and nutritional value of the food product. Unlike other preservation methods such as canning or freezing, hyophilisé does not alter the taste, texture, or nutritional content of the food. This makes hyophilisé a preferred method for preserving foods that are sensitive to heat or have a delicate flavor profile.

hyophilisé is also a convenient method for food storage and transportation. Since the final product is lightweight and stable at room temperature, hyophilisé foods are easy to store and transport. This makes hyophilisé ideal for camping, hiking, or any outdoor activities where refrigeration is not available. Hyophilisé foods are also popular among astronauts and military personnel who require lightweight and long-lasting food supplies.

In addition to its benefits in the food industry, hyophilisé is also used in other fields such as pharmaceuticals, cosmetics, and biotechnology. In the pharmaceutical industry, hyophilisé is used to preserve vaccines, antibiotics, and other sensitive medications that require stability at room temperature. Hyophilisé is also used in the cosmetic industry to preserve natural ingredients and maintain the efficacy of skincare products.

Despite its numerous benefits, hyophilisé also has some limitations. One of the main drawbacks of hyophilisé is the cost involved in the process. The equipment required for hyophilisé is expensive, and the process itself is time-consuming. This makes hyophilisé a cost-prohibitive option for small-scale producers or individuals looking to preserve food at home.

Another limitation of hyophilisé is its impact on the environment. The energy consumption and greenhouse gas emissions associated with hyophilisé are significant, making it less sustainable compared to other preservation methods such as canning or dehydrating. As consumer demand for sustainable and eco-friendly products continues to grow, there is a need for more research and development to reduce the environmental impact of hyophilisé.
